The Vori language spoken by the Vori, when rendered through the universal translator, retained a distinct structure and used synonyms and metaphors for everyday words and with a military-oriented syntax.
Terms for an extended family used combinations of immediate family terms (i.e. mother's father rather than grandfather.) (VOY: "Nemesis")
Words and phrases[]
- Ally – friend
- Backwalk – back off / retreat ("it is sharper to backwalk")
- Beast – the face of the enemy; in addition, this word was used to imply that the enemy was completely immoral.
- Before – the past
- Blossoms – flowers
- Brightly – happily / cheerfully
- Clash – a war / a fight ("you've landed right in the middle of a clash")
- Cluster – to regroup ("it would be sharp to cluster with the others")
- Cluster mark – rendezvous point
- Colors – markings / uniform
- Cook – burn, cook, heat ("cooked by The Glare")
- Coverings – clothes ("they were his coverings")
- Crave – want ("do you crave any more?")
- Daughter's daughter – maternal granddaughter
- Defender – soldier
- Drill – teach ("Drill Chakotay to fire Vori arms.")
- Fast-walk – run / quick-march / rush ("they were fast-walked to the Extermination center")
- Fathom – to know / to understand / to think ("you don't fathom the Nemesis")
- Flame – to burn ("they flamed all our villages")
- Fleet colors – Starfleet uniform
- Footfalls – paces, a measure of distance
- Fullness – the whole story, summary of a situation
- The Glare – the Sun ("glimpse the glare")
- Glimpse – to see / an eye ("did you glimpse the Nemesis?"; "close your glimpses")
- Gloried – highly held / glorified / great
- Greeted – welcomed
- Grey – old (person) ("he's too grey to be of use")
- In the now – in the present
- Motherless – generic insult
- Mother's father – maternal grandfather
- Mother's mother – maternal grandmother
- Nemesis – enemy
- New-light – dawn
- Novice – rookie, a newly-trained soldier
- Nullify, nully – to kill / to be killed ("they were nullified")
- Plantings – crops / harvest ("they took our plantings" / "two plantings ago")
- Power – religious / god-concept ("We beg peace from the Power who made us Vori...")
- Rages – anger ("you turn your Trembles into Rages")
- Savory – tasty ("I'm afraid it's not very savory")
- Set loose – let go ( "Set my mother's father loose! Please! Let him loose!" )
- Sharp – clever / wise / smart / better ("it would be sharp to wait until new-light")
- Shroud – hide
- Signal – call / contact
- Sly – hide ("sly yourselves and fire back!")
- Soon-after – future ("In the soon-after, we'll send them flying from this sphere")
- Sphere – planet
- Sturdy – strong ("He's very gray, and his heart's not sturdy")
- Suffice – enough ("But does it suffice him to nullify you?")
- Tellings – words / knowledge; orders ("do my tellings")
- Tend – care for / protect
- Toiling – working
- The trembles – fear / cowardice ("you've got the trembles")
- Told – said ("well told, Novice.")
- Top – head ("keep your top low and your glimpses wide")
- Trunks – trees / woods ("we found him in the trunks")
- Upturned – a Vori burial disgrace, a body facing upwards after death so as to not go to the Way-after
- Way-after – the term for the Vori afterlife ("he's passed to the way-after")
- Wrestle – struggle against, overcome
